A human artificial chromosome hac is a microchromosome that can act as a new chromosome in a population of human cells. Since their description in the late 1990s, human artificial chromosomes hacs carrying a functional kinetochore were considered as a promising system for gene delivery and expression with a potential to overcome many problems caused by the use of viralbased gene transfer systems. Because the human genome is too large to be sequenced from one end to the other in one go it has to be split up into manageable chunks. She asserted that human artificial chromosomes are sometimes known as chromosome 47 as the normal complement of chromosomes in human cells is 46, explaining that the advantage in gene therapy is that the 47th chromosome doesnt interfere with the other 46 chromosomes, unlike conventional gene therapy where an extra gene is inserted often at random into the human genome.

Artificial chromosomes and minichromosomelike episomes are large dna molecules capable of containing whole genomic loci, and be maintained as nonintegrating, replicating molecules in proliferating human somatic cells.
